The Importance of Sustainable Tourism

Sustainable tourism aims to protect natural and cultural resources while providing a positive experience for both visitors and locals. By supporting sustainable tourism practices, travelers can help reduce carbon emissions, conserve natural habitats, and promote social inclusivity.

Key Benefits of Sustainable Tourism:

  • Preservation of natural resources
  • Social and economic benefits for local communities
  • Enhanced cultural exchange and appreciation
  • Reduced carbon footprint

Tips for Sustainable Travel

As a sustainable traveler, there are many actions you can take to minimize your impact on the environment and support local communities. Here are some practical tips to help you go green while exploring the globe:

Key Tips:

  1. Choose eco-friendly accommodations
  2. Support local businesses and artisans
  3. Reduce plastic waste by using reusable water bottles and bags
  4. Respect local customs and traditions
  5. Minimize your carbon footprint by opting for public transportation or walking

FAQs

Q: How can I find eco-friendly accommodations?

A: Look for certifications such as LEED or Green Key, read reviews from other sustainable travelers, and choose hotels that prioritize energy efficiency and waste reduction.

Q: What can I do to support local communities during my travels?

A: Eat at local restaurants, shop from local artisans, participate in community-based tours, and respect the customs and traditions of the destination.
